Output 529abe62b250c4a0777a378e258b108428345852d276b0b47ef839ae4c8fb2fc:2

value
72908886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 020690d1f47c4ca72bf4771c8c9cb5c4296fcd0c OP_EQUAL
address
M85sT1Mb6KyPiLxLJKipGMWjtqFEE1SVF8
transaction
529abe62b250c4a0777a378e258b108428345852d276b0b47ef839ae4c8fb2fc
spent
true